India#39;s tech spend is now becoming normalised with the developing world: Satya Nadella

Responding to a question on Microsoft#39;s future in helping the Indian economy, Nadella said “there is overall economy, economic growth and there is tech spend. That gap is bridging. India#39;s tech spend as a percentage of GDP is now becoming normalised with the developing world.”
